The price of filing tax obligations might differ, mainly depending on the approach picked and the taxpayer's distinct economic situations. Typical methods of filing tax obligations include self-preparation using tax obligation software program, getting the aid of a tax professional, or making use of free resources provided by the federal government for those that qualify. Consider the case of a freelance graphic designer that generally sustains $500 in tax prep work charges.

DIY tax software application usually costs in between $30 and $150, relying on the intricacy of your return. In contrast, professional tax services can vary from $200 to $1,000 or even more, depending upon the intricacy of your tax situation and the accounting professional's fees.
